As a Full-Time Water Production Operator in Haltom City, you will take the helm in monitoring and maintaining the intricate water system that keeps our community thriving. Your role will involve conducting essential water sampling, ensuring that our residents enjoy access to clean and safe water every day. You'll also provide valuable maintenance assistance to other City departments, fostering collaboration and a sense of shared purpose.

What you need to be successful

To thrive as a Full-Time Water Production Operator in Haltom City, you'll need computer skills, well-defined problem-solving abilities as well as attention to detail. A High School Diploma or GED is your ticket in, but experience is key—specifically, 2 years of hands-on experience working to maintain a water system. Your ability to adapt and learn will be crucial, especially as you work towards obtaining a TCEQ Water Distribution license within two years of joining our team.

Knowledge and skills required for the position are:

  • High School Diploma or GED
  • 2 years' experience working in a water system
  • Class C Water Distribution license or the ability to obtain within two years
